The document discusses how the properties of materials change at the nanoscale level. It provides examples of how gold, magnets, wire, carbon, and glass exhibit different properties when structured as nanoparticles compared to their bulk form. At the nanoscale, materials can acquire new properties due to increased surface area effects and a higher percentage of surface atoms. This leads to potential applications in areas like electronics, medicine, and consumer products.

Experiment with natural nanomaterials - nanotechnologyNANOYOU
n this experiment you will analyse some innovative materials that are highly water repellent, stainless and require less cleaning thanks to their surface nano-engineering. Those materials have been developed using nature as an inspiration, since some plant leaves have exceptional properties due to their surface composition.
The property you will analyse is the superhydrophobic effect found in some leaves, such as the lotus leaf. The effect is due to interplay of surface chemistry and surface topography at the micro- and nano-level. Nanotechnology is an interdisciplinary subject. A large number of techniques like physical, mechanical, chemical, biological and hybrid are available to synthesize different types of nanomatericals. Synthesized nanoparticles are in the form of colloids, clusters, powders, tubes, rods, wires and thin films etc. The technique to be used depends upon the material of interest, type of nanomaterial, size and quantity. 'Nano', a Greek word that means 'dwarf’.
The word 'nano' is used to refer to 10-9 or a billionth part of one meter.
The term 'Nanotechnology' was first defined by Taniguchi of the Tokyo Science University in 1974.
It is generally used for materials of size between 1 to 100 nm.• They are also referred to as Nanoparticles.
In Nanotechnology, a particle is a small object that behaves as a unit with respect to its transport and properties.

27. Definitions So what is nanoscience? Nanoscience is the study of phenomena and manipulation of materials at the atomic, molecular and macromolecular scales where properties differ significantly from those at a larger scale. So what is nanotechnology? Nanotechnology is the design, characterisation, production and application of structures, devices and systems by controlling shape and size at the nanometre scale. Definition from Royal Society and Royal Academy for Engineering 2004
